Thousands attend #March4Justice rallies across Australia
Thousands of women have marched at events across the country to demand action in response to allegations of workplace abuse and gendered violence.
In Canberra, in front of Parliament House, Brittany Higgins made a powerful speech decrying 'the system is broken'.
Sexual abuse survivor and Australian of the year Grace Tame told a crowd in Hobart that 'behaviour unspoken, behaviour ignored, is behaviour endorsed', adding that the solution was simple: 'making noise'
